Marie-Josephe CAOUETTE was born 21 August 1745 in Cap-St-Ignace, Canada, New France

Marie-Josephe CAOUETTE was the child of Joseph CAOUETTE   and   Marthe BOULET (BOULAY) and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Pierre CAOUETTE (CAOUET) and Anne GAUDREAU (maternal)  Jacques BOULET (BOULAY) and Agathe MORIN

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Marie-Josephe  married  Pierre-Noel FREGEAU dit LA PLANCHE 27 February 1764 in Cap-St-Ignace, Province of Québec, Canada .  The couple had (at least) 2 children.
Pierre-Noel FREGEAU dit LA PLANCHE  was born 25 December 1744 in Saint-François-de-la-Rivière-du-Sud, Québec, Canada (Saint-François-de-Sales-de-la-Rivière-du-Sud).  Pierre-Noel died 25 September 1829 in Cap-St-Ignace, Québec, Canada (Saint-Ignace-de-Loyola).  Pierre-Noel was the child of Pierre-Noel FREGEAU dit LA PLANCHE and Marie-Louise QUEMENEUR dite LAFLAMME.

Marie-Josephe CAOUETTE died 31 August 1802 in Cap-St-Ignace, Lower Canada .

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
